The S&P 500 has been more expensive than it is now on only one occasion in almost a century and a half. On a cyclically adjusted basis, it trades at around 42 times earnings. The single clear precedent for that figure is 1999 to 2000; the peak before it was 1929. Both are on the chart below, along with the decade each led into. _(Neil in the margin: The stock-market peak before the Wall Street Crash. The Dow lost roughly 90% of its value from 1929 to its 1932 bottom, and did not reclaim the peak in nominal terms until 1954.)_

## What CAPE measures

_[Embedded media](https://en.wikipedia.org/wiki/Robert_J._Shiller)_

A conventional price-to-earnings ratio divides today’s price by a single year’s earnings, which makes it almost useless when things change. Earnings collapse in a recession, and the ratio looks frighteningly high; earnings peak in a boom, and it looks reassuringly low, both at exactly the wrong moment. Robert Shiller's adjustment is simple. Divide the price by the average of the past 10 years’ earnings, adjusted for inflation. Ten years covers a broader economic cycle, so no single year can flatter or distort the reading.

The result is the [cyclically adjusted price/earnings ratio](https://en.wikipedia.org/wiki/Cyclically_adjusted_price-to-earnings_ratio), also written P/E10 or the Shiller CAPE. Its long-run average sits in the high teens. Today's reading of roughly 42 is more than double that. _(Neil in the margin: Since 1881 the CAPE has averaged around 17. Note the average itself has drifted up over the decades, which is partly what the "unfair to the present" caveat later is about.)_

## Cheap starts pay. Expensive starts do not.

Read the crosses on the chart from the bottom up. Out of the troughs, the following decade was extraordinary. From the single-digit CAPE of 1921, the market returned 269% in nominal terms and 345% in real terms over the next ten years. From 1932, 216% and 163%. From the 1982 low, 475% and 299%. From 2009, 338% and 267%. _(Neil in the margin: Real means after stripping out inflation. It exceeds the nominal figure here because the early 1930s saw deflation, so a pound bought more each year — the mirror image of the 1970s effect he flags later.)_

From the peaks, it ran the other way. The decade after 1929 returned −29% in nominal terms and −13% in real terms. The decade after 2000, −9% nominal and −29% real. Same market, same measure. The only thing that changed was the price paid at the start.

> The same ten years can show a gain on the screen and a loss in your pocket.

One cross is worth stopping on. From 1966, with a CAPE near 24, the market returned 53% in nominal terms over the following decade. In real terms, it lost 12%. The inflation of the 1970s did that: the quoted number kept climbing while purchasing power fell behind it. The starting valuation is what most separates the two figures. _(Neil in the margin: UK inflation peaked above 20% in 1975; US CPI ran into double digits twice that decade. Nominal share prices can rise while your purchasing power quietly erodes — the whole reason CAPE is inflation-adjusted in the first place.)_

## The same signal, every month since 1881

The previous time series chart picks out eight moments. The chart below plots every single one. Each dot represents a single month, with its valuation on the horizontal axis and the annualised real 10 year return that actually followed on the vertical axis.

The cloud slopes down and to the right. Buy at a low multiple, and the outcomes fan out high; buy at a high one, and they compress toward zero, and the strong decades simply stop appearing. At the far right, where the market sits today, the historical record holds no example of a good ten years to follow.

## Four things it cannot tell you

Valuation is a powerful lens and a poor clock. Four limits are worth holding in view.

1. It says nothing about **timing**. CAPE was already high in 1997, and the market climbed for three more years before it broke. Expensive can become more expensive and stay there. _(Neil in the margin: The classic timing problem: valuation told you the 1990s market was dear well before it topped in 2000. Being early is, in practice, indistinguishable from being wrong.)_

2. The comparison may be unfair to the present. Accounting rules have changed, companies now return cash through buybacks as much as through dividends, and the index is dominated by asset-light technology businesses earning far higher returns on capital than the railroads and steelmakers in the old data. A market like that can reasonably carry some premium to its own history. This time really might be different. _(Neil in the margin: Companies buy back their own shares instead of paying dividends. Because buybacks lift per-share earnings and were rare in the older data, some argue today's CAPE isn't strictly comparable with a century ago.)_

3. **Interest rates** change the sum. When the safe return is low, a higher multiple on equities is easier to justify. Part of the re-rating since 2009 is rational rather than manic. _(Neil in the margin: A re-rating means investors agreeing to pay a higher multiple for the same earnings. With bond yields floored near zero after 2009, equities looked relatively more attractive — so part of the rise is arithmetic, not mania.)_

4. It is a **probability**, not a promise. The scatter is a cloud, not a rule. High starts have led to weak decades far more often than strong ones. The word “often” is the important one.

## How Neil reads it

Neil does not use CAPE to call a top. Nobody can, and the history of those who tried is not flattering. He uses it to answer a single question: what am I starting from? A reading of 42 does not say sell, nor does it say when. It says the market is priced for a decade in which very little is allowed to go wrong, and that the margin for error is thin.

That is a reason to know exactly what you own and why you own it, not a reason to watch the number each morning. The price paid is the one variable an investor controls completely, and across ten years, it is the one that counts the most.
